[👾Troubleshooting] 동적 배포와 정적 배포 문제 (REACT)
React 프로젝트를 Docker와 Nginx로 배포하는 과정에서 404 오류와 외부 API 호출 문제를 겪어 남기게 된 글이다. 1. 문제1-1. 새로고침 404문제첫쨰는 새로고침했을 때 나타나는 404 문제다.React-Route을 통해서 서브 페이지를 만들어놓고, 사용자가 접속한 후 새로고침을 하면페이지가 404로 날아가버리는 문제가 있었다. 이는 톰캣과 같은 WAS에 정적 빌드파일을 올렸을 때 나타난 문제와 동일한데,404로 연결될 때 리다이렉트 주소를 React 주소와 맞춰주면 해결되는 요소다.하지만 본 프로젝트에선 WAS를 쓰지 않고 있음에도 나타난 문제다. 1-2. 외부 API를 못 읽는 문제문제를 인지한 건 프로젝트에 Chart.js와 같은 외부 라이브러리를 읽어온 뒤, 사용하는 과정에서 ..